Reverse Osmosis, commonly referred to as RO, is a process where you demineralize or deionize water by pushing it under pressure through a semi-permeable Reverse Osmosis Membrane. Osmosis. To understand the purpose and process of Reverse Osmosis you must first understand the naturally occurring process of Osmosis.

Get PriceReverse osmosis will remove several mineral and chemical materials from water, including salt, fluoride, lead, manganese, iron, and calcium. Reverse osmosis, because it removes minerals according to physical size, is non-selective in its removal of dangerous and beneficial minerals.

Accepta 2091 can be used in reverse osmosis applications where the reject brine silica levels are as high as 230 ppm at 30oC and pH 7.5. Scaling and deposits build up on the reverse osmosis membranes leading to poor permeate quality, low permeate production and increased water and energy costs.

Get PriceA reverse osmosis filter system works by using pressure to force water though a semi-permeable membrane. To perform at its best, water should be filtered through an activated carbon filter to remove chlorine and many organic chemicals, and/or a reactive carbon filter designed to remove chloramines.
